Summary

Two residents used public comment at the March 18 meeting to urge changes: Jean King called for term limits and criticized council spending and accountability; Brian Mansfield accused council of endorsing candidates with problematic histories and urged withdrawal of endorsements. A council member responded denying endorsements.

Two residents spoke during the public-comment portion of the March 18 Mentor City Council meeting, pressing the council on accountability, term limits and past endorsements.
